Fan Balancing Service in Alpharetta, GA
Fan balancing services involve adjusting the weight distribution of ceiling fans, exhaust fans, or other household fans to ensure smooth and efficient operation. This process helps reduce wobbling, noise, and uneven wear on fan components, which can extend the lifespan of the fan and improve comfort within a home. Projects typically include balancing ceiling fans in living rooms, bedrooms, kitchens, or outdoor spaces, as well as larger exhaust or ventilation fans used in utility areas. Homeowners often seek this service when experiencing excessive noise, visible wobbling, or vibration, aiming to restore proper function and prevent potential damage.
Before requesting fan balancing, property owners usually want to understand the type of fan needing service, the symptoms experienced, and any previous issues such as imbalance or noise. It’s helpful to know the fan’s location and whether it has been recently installed or repaired. Clarifying these details can assist in determining the best approach for balancing the fan and ensuring it operates quietly and efficiently. Properly balanced fans can contribute to a more comfortable and quieter living environment.

Fan Balancing Service Questions
What is fan balancing service? It involves adjusting the fan blades to ensure they rotate smoothly and reduce vibrations, improving performance and longevity.
Why should property owners consider fan balancing? Proper balancing can prevent noise, reduce wear on parts, and improve energy efficiency of ceiling and exhaust fans.
Which types of fans benefit from balancing services? Ceiling fans, exhaust fans, and industrial fans can all benefit from professional balancing to ensure optimal operation.
How often should fans be balanced? Fans should be balanced when they start making noise, wobble, or show signs of uneven operation for better performance and safety.
